Ordinals
beta
Sat 771380430855668
decimal
154276.430855668
degree
0°154276′1060″430855668‴
percentile
36.73240150972318%
name
ijrgqywliuf
cycle
0
epoch
0
period
76
block
154276
offset
430855668
timestamp
2011-11-22 01:45:47 UTC
rarity
common
prev
next